The Federal Reserve Bank of Minneapolis supports the Federal Reserve System (System) in ensuring a safe, sound, and accessible banking system and stable financial markets through supervision and regulation of the nation's banking, financial and payments systems and through effective implementation of statutes that inform and protect the consumer. This bank also works with other federal and state agencies and regulators to promote safety and soundness in the operation of the financial industry and fair and equitable treatment of consumers in their financial transactions.

We currently have a role open for an IT/Cybersecurity risk specialist in the System Analytics and Support group, participating on cybersecurity examinations of firms in the System’s Large and Foreign Banking Organization (LFBO) portfolio. This role will lead or participate on the LFBO’s annual horizontal cybersecurity examination of firms in the LFBO portfolio, as well as other IT/cybersecurity examinations of firms in the portfolio, as needed. This includes assessing cybersecurity practices, operational resilience programs, and information technology infrastructures to ensure they are operating in a safe and sound manner and complying with applicable banking laws, regulations, and policy statements. The candidate will also lead or participate on other examination activities, as determined by management.

The LFBO portfolio supervises all U.S. institutions with total assets of more than $100 billion and all foreign banking organizations operating in the United States regardless of size that are supervised by the System but not subject to Large Institution Supervision Coordinating Committee (LISCC) portfolio supervision, which is responsible for overseeing the supervision of the largest, most systemically important institutions.

*This position requires access to confidential supervisory information and/or FOMC information, which is limited to "Protected Individuals" as defined in the U.S. federal immigration law. Protected Individuals include, but are not limited to, U.S. citizens, U.S. nationals, and U.S. permanent residents who either are not yet eligible to apply for naturalization or who have applied for naturalization within the requisite timeframe. Candidates who are not U.S. citizens or U.S. permanent residents may be eligible for the information access required for this position and sponsorship for a work visa, and subsequently for permanent residence, if they sign a declaration of intent to become a U.S. citizen and meet other eligibility requirements. In addition, all candidates must undergo applicable background checks and comply with all applicable information handling rules, and all non-U.S. citizens must sign a declaration of intent to become a U.S. citizen and pursue a path to citizenship.
